Recommended Dosage

The dosage of Levitra can vary based on individual needs and health conditions. Here are some general guidelines:

  1. Starting Dose: The typical starting dose for Levitra is 10 mg, taken approximately 30 minutes before sexual activity.
  2. Adjusting the Dose: Based on efficacy and tolerability, the dose may be adjusted to 20 mg or decreased to 5 mg.
  3. Frequency of Use: Levitra should not be taken more than once a day.

Factors Influencing Dosage

Several factors can affect the appropriate dosage of Levitra for an individual:

  • Age: Older adults may require lower doses due to changes in metabolism.
  • Health Conditions: Conditions such as liver or kidney problems can necessitate adjustments.
  • Concurrent Medications: Certain medications can interact with Levitra, affecting its dosage and efficacy.
